GORDO AND KOTTKE HIT THE ROAD

  • View Comments
  • Send to a Friend

Leo Kottke and Mike Gordon will play twenty-five shows at large clubs and theatres this fall, beginning September 15 at Liberty Hall in Lawrence, KS and wrapping up November 2 at the 9:30 Club in Washington, DC. The tour also includes a previously announced mainstage appearance at the Austin City Limits Festival in Austin, Texas on September 23.

A limited quantity of tickets for all shows (except the Austin City Limits Festival and Stanford University show) are available beginning Tuesday, August 9 at 10 a.m. EST via Mike & Leo's secure online ticketing system located at kottkegordontickets.rlc.net.

Tickets for all shows go on-sale through public outlets over the next couple of weeks. Please note that some dates may be 21+.
